Introduction Study Area

This study records the existing conditions of the portion of The Academics, Research, and Support Services Design Area is campus known as the “Academics, Research, and Support bounded by Franklin Boulevard on the north, Agate Street on the Services Design Area” as they relate to the university’s Campus east, 13th Avenue on the south, and the University Street Axis on Plan’s policies and patterns. The series of diagnosis maps the west. The area includes a wide variety of academic, research, contained in the report depicts areas that need fixing and areas and support service uses. Because the area is adjacent to that work well. Franklin Boulevard, it is the university’s most visible edge to the community. The Lokey Science Complex is the campus’s most The study will aid in decision making for potential development densely developed area and occupies the majority of the study of the area, as well as help identify the need for future area. Student services and administrative functions occupy the amendments to the Campus Plan. eastern section adjacent to Agate Street, the major gateway to the campus. Future plans for development will have an impact on The principle of diagnosis is one of the six basic principles of the all portions of this study area. planning process adopted by the university in 1974, known as “,” and elaborated upon in the Campus Process Plan: Areas of the campus shall be studied periodically for This study was conducted primarily by Campus Planning and their health. These diagnostic studies shall enumerate Real Estate staff. In addition, a focus group of area users was shortcomings and assets contained within the study area. formed and numerous staff members were consulted to gather These studies allow for the identification of areas needing input. repair. This in turn opens possibilities for site repair as part of future construction projects in the area. In this way individual Prior to engaging the focus group, applicable Campus Plan projects contribute to the improvement of the campus as a patterns and policies were identified. A series of base data maps whole. (p. 26) showing existing conditions related to these policies and patterns were prepared to assist in determining whether the Campus This diagnostic study is only one step in the planning process to Plan’s policies and patterns are effective in the study area. guide future development. As stated by Christopher Alexander in his book The Oregon Experiment, “The diagnosis tells us what The focus group was asked to provide input about the health of is wrong, now, in the present” (p. 157). The diagnosis is not the study area. Prior to meeting, focus group members were intended to establish policies and patterns, but determines asked to take a tour of the area to acquaint themselves with, or how the established policies and patterns are working. It is remind themselves of, the opportunities and issues that relate to not intended to present the university with specific solutions this area. Comments from focus group members and staff were for individual projects, but analyzes the combined effect past incorporated into the diagnosis maps that depict areas that need projects have had on the university environment. fixing and areas that work well.

Northeast Campus Diagnosis Page 30 Opportunities and Constraints The university’s edge should serve as a green respite from the commercial development along Franklin Boulevard. While it is desirable to buffer parking and service areas, open-space and landscape elements should enhance views into campus whenever possible rather than serve as buffers.

Ensure that development does not create a “wall” of buildings along Franklin Boulevard. Unlike most open spaces, buildings should not define the edge of this open space, which parallels Franklin Boulevard; rather, a stepped form of development, interspersed with pathways and larger open spaces that provide access and views into campus, is more appropriate. University ownership on both sides of the boulevard gives an opportunity to convey the image of driving “through” rather than “by” the campus. Consider expanding designated open-space boundaries to accomplish this.

Franklin Boulevard Axis

Pathways/Gateways - This axis contains a primary east/west pathway for pedestrians and bicyclists traveling to and through the university. This pathway continues east along Franklin Boulevard through the Agate Street Entrance Green and west along the northern edge of the Old Campus Quadrangle. Intersections with pathways at Onyx Street, the Science Green (through the Lewis Integrative Science Building), between Deschutes and Oregon Halls, and others provide access into campus.

No established mid-block Franklin Boulevard pedestrian crossing exists; however, pedestrians cross mid-block creating an informal and unsafe connection to North Campus.

Opportunities and Constraints - Preserve and enhance pedestrian and bike access along Franklin Boulevard. Also

Northeast Campus Diagnosis Page 49 Sustainable Development The University of Oregon Model for Sustainable Development addresses the unique aspects of campus buildings and Map: Sustainable Development: Energy and Stormwater (p. 25) t landscapes by focusing on what matters most: ENERGY, WATER, AND PEOPLE The map associated with this section addresses the following Campus Plan policies and patterns: ENERGY The university has capped total campus energy use from new development projects. This is achieved by taking a systematic Policy 10: Sustainable Development campus-wide approach (as opposed to building by building). New development projects are required to achieve a state-of-the- The development, repair, maintenance, and operations of art energy performance level—an Advanced Energy Threshold. the University of Oregon today have an impact on the local Also, energy-savings measures are required in existing facilities environment and the ability of future generations to thrive. to offset the resulting energy needs generated by the new projects. This will result in a net zero increase in campus energy All development, redevelopment, and remodeling on the use from new development. University of Oregon campus shall incorporate sustainable design principles including existing and future land use, WATER landscaping, building, and transportation plans as described The university will improve the quality of campus stormwater in the policy refinement below. emitted into the region’s waterways by focusing on campus areas that contribute the most to the degradation of water quality— Patterns campus streets and parking lots. New development projects are (Refer to the Campus Plan for the complete pattern text.) required to treat the equivalent amount of stormwater runoff as required by city code; however, some of the areas treated will • Campus Trees be shifted outside the project site to address relatively low water • Environmental Mitigation (Campus Tree Plan) quality campus areas—streets and parking lots. • Flexibility and Longevity • Operable Windows PEOPLE • Site Repair The university ensures sustained energy conservation habits. • Sustainable Development New development projects are required to develop a plan and • Use Wisely What We Have implement educational/training opportunities about the building • Water Quality and/or landscape in order to create and sustain a shift in occu- pant behavior.

Policy Refinements LEED (Refer to the Campus Plan for the complete text.) All new development projects must achieve Leadership in Energy and Environmental Design (LEED) Gold certification. All construction projects shall adhere to the university’s Oregon Model for Sustainable Development:
